Description
Describe the bug
During boot, kwalletd5-wrap dumps core: systemd-coredump[1204]: Process 1095 (.kwalletd5-wrap) of user 1000 dumped core.
This prevents kde wallet to authenticate together with my session, and I need to re-enter the password after logging in.
To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:
- Configure system with kde plasma5 and sddm
- Boot it
Expected behavior
kdewallet should not crash on boot
